Perhaps the most extraordinary story featured was the discovery of gold and silver coins in Florida waters, valued at approximately $1 million. These historical treasures originated from Spanish ships that sank in the 1700s, offering a tangible connection to maritime history and the age of exploration. Such findings captivate our imagination and remind us that historical artifacts continue to emerge centuries later, telling stories of trade, travel, and the perils faced by sailors long ago. The preservation of these coins through centuries underwater speaks to both the durability of precious metals and the importance of archaeological efforts that help us piece together our collective past through physical objects that have survived against remarkable odds.
